Understanding Gallbladder Disease in American Men

Gallbladder disease, including gallstones and cholecystitis, is a significant health concern in the United States. While traditionally more common in women, recent data indicate a rising incidence among men, particularly those in middle age and older. Factors such as obesity, rapid weight loss, and a sedentary lifestyle contribute to this trend, making effective management and prevention strategies crucial.

Safety and Administration of Delatestryl

Delatestryl is administered via intramuscular injection, typically every two to four weeks, depending on the patient's needs and response to treatment. As with any medication, safety is paramount. Endo Pharmaceuticals emphasizes the importance of regular monitoring of testosterone levels and liver function to ensure the safe use of Delatestryl. Potential side effects include acne, changes in libido, and mood swings, but these are generally manageable with proper medical supervision.
